Product Description

Manufacturer's Description

Expand your creative options with this huge archive of sounds and loops. From house and garage, to drum and bass, to cutting edge global sounds, this Sound Collection will add an original touch to your work. This massive 7, 500 sample archive, of which each and every sample has been created by professional musicians, is in wave format and different BPM's so that you can use them in a variety of music programs. In typical eJay style, the collection comes complete with an intuitive tool to help you listen and select your favorite samples. The eJay Sound Browser will help you search for that particular sound, by style, BPM, tempo and instrument. Once you've selected your samples, use the RealStretch Timestretcher to convert it to your preferred tempo. Containing sounds from a huge selection of 26 genre's, this is a must have addition to your music creation armory.

4.0 out of 5 stars Decent Sounz, 8 April 2001
By Paul Williams "hardworx" (UK)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
The sound browser is most useful for this wide-ranging collection of sounds but it can be a bit fiddly to get used to at first - the only real problem is that once you have found a few bits of noize you like, you then have to transfer them to your hard disk so that you can then import them (as WAVs) into your music software - I believe later collections do have the option of saving as PXD format.

I don't feel the time stretching worked that well - but that could just be me!
